Is Turkey on your travel wish list? If not, here’s something to think about. This summer, plan a trip to the Cappadocia region in central Anatolia, Turkey. Here, you will find the richest of cultures and some of the most beautiful sights there are.
Cappadocia is known for its unique and otherworldly landscapes, including rock formations, fairy chimneys, and cave dwellings. It spans across the provinces of Nevşehir, Kayseri, Aksaray, and Niğde. The region has become a popular tourist destination due to its stunning natural beauty and rich historical and cultural heritage. Let’s explore!
As per studies, it all began some 60 million years ago when volcanic eruptions covered the region with layers of ash, lava, and basalt.
What makes the fairy chimneys even more intriguing is the human element intertwined with nature. These rock formations, for centuries, were a part of human settlements. Throughout history, people carved dwellings, churches, and entire underground cities into the soft volcanic rock.

Some of these caves served as homes and places of worship, while some provided shelter and protection from invasions.
Today, these rock formations are not only a historical testament but also a major tourist attraction. The combination of the fairy chimneys, ancient cave dwellings, and rich cultural heritage make Cappadocia a truly extraordinary destination.
